您的位置:首页 > 运维架构 > 反向代理

nginx配置反向代理以及负载均衡

2020-04-26 18:45 639 查看

举例

配置反向代理
// nginx/conf目录下的nginx.conf
//添加
upstream xxx-name-xxx{
server 192.168.xxx.xxx:8080;
}
server {
listen 80; # 默认端口号
server_name www.xxx.com; # 域名

location / {
proxy_pass http://xxx-name-xxx;
index index.html; # 默认访问资源名称
}
}
配置负载均衡
// nginx/conf目录下的nginx.conf
//添加
upstream xxx-name-xxx{
server 192.168.xxx.xxx:8080 weight=2; # weight=2表示权重为2,默认为1. 所以此时8080流量会多一点
server 192.168.xxx.xxx:8081;
server 192.168.xxx.xxx:8082;
}
server {
listen 80; # 默认端口号
server_name www.xxx.com; # 域名

location / {
proxy_pass http://xxx-name-xxx;
index index.html; # 默认访问资源名称
}
}
  • 点赞
  • 收藏
  • 分享
  • 文章举报
wjh-one 发布了6 篇原创文章 · 获赞 4 · 访问量 163 私信 关注
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: